Abstract. The scheme of a measurement experiment to determine the reflection coefficient of sound from a material sample using a virtual low-element phased radiating array is considered. The results of modeling are presented, confirming the possibility of synthesizing a sound wave with the front parameters necessary for irradiation of the sample. Supplementing the weighting of the radiation signals by amplitude by weighing by phase makes it possible to reduce the number of array nodes many times — from four hundred for a measurement scheme using a virtual Trott array to twenty-five in the considered examples. This makes it possible to significantly reduce the labor intensity and duration of the measurement experiment, to reduce the risk of the influence of factors caused by the instability of the measurement conditions over time.
